Ingredients

  • 2 oz Rum: The star of the show! Use your favorite rum—white or dark—depending on how bold you want the drink to be.
  • 1 oz Fresh Lime Juice: Fresh is key! Squeezing your own lime gives it a bright, zesty flavor.
  • 1 oz Simple Syrup: This sweetener brings everything together; you can easily make it at home by dissolving equal parts sugar and water!
  • Club Soda: Adds that refreshing fizziness! It’s also a great way to lighten up the drink.
  • Ice: Chill your cocktail to perfection!
  • Fresh Mint Leaves (for garnish): A sprig of mint not only looks beautiful but adds an invigorating aroma.
  • Lime Wedge (for garnish): A pop of color and an extra zesty kick!

How to Make It

1. Fill a Shaker with Ice

Grab your favorite cocktail shaker and fill it with ice cubes. The sound of ice clinking together is music to my ears—let the party begin!

2. Add Rum, Lime Juice, and Simple Syrup

Pour in the 2 oz of rum, then add 1 oz fresh lime juice and 1 oz of simple syrup. Take a moment to inhale those fresh lime aromas; you’re already halfway to paradise!

3. Shake Well Until Chilled

Put the lid on your shaker tightly and shake, shake, shake! You want this drink to be as cold as a breeze on a hot summer day.

4. Strain the Mixture into a Glass Filled with Ice

Using a strainer, pour your delicious mixture over a glass filled with ice. Watch as the beautiful liquid splashes over the ice, creating a refreshing cascade.

5. Top with Club Soda and Stir Gently

Add a splash of club soda on top for that effervescent finish. Give it a gentle stir, and just like that, your cocktail is taking shape!

6. Garnish and Serve

Finish with fresh mint leaves and a lime wedge for garnish. This drink isn’t just a treat for your taste buds; it’s also a feast for your eyes! Serve immediately and enjoy!

Pro Tips for Success

  • Chill your glass: For an extra cool experience, chill your glass in the freezer for about 10 minutes before pouring.
  • Use fresh ingredients: Fresh-squeezed lime juice and mint make a world of difference.
  • Adjust sweetness: Taste and adjust the simple syrup to your liking. If you prefer a tart drink, skip the syrup!
  • Ice matters: Use larger ice cubes—they melt slower and won’t dilute your cocktail too quickly.

Ultimate Rum Cocktail

A delightful tropical cocktail that combines rum, fresh lime juice, simple syrup, and club soda for a refreshing experience.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Total Time 10 minutes
Servings: 1 cocktail
Course: Beverage, Cocktail
Cuisine: Caribbean, Tropical
Calories: 200

Ingredients
  

Cocktail Ingredients
  • 2 oz Rum Use your favorite rum—white or dark.
  • 1 oz Fresh Lime Juice Freshly squeezed is best.
  • 1 oz Simple Syrup Easily made by dissolving equal parts sugar and water.
  • to top oz Club Soda For that refreshing fizz.
  • as needed Ice To chill the cocktail.
  • 1 sprig Fresh Mint Leaves For garnish.
  • 1 wedge Lime For garnish.

Method
 

Preparation
  1. Fill a shaker with ice cubes.
  2. Add 2 oz of rum, 1 oz fresh lime juice, and 1 oz of simple syrup into the shaker.
  3. Shake well until the mixture is chilled.
  4. Strain the mixture into a glass filled with ice.
  5. Top with club soda and stir gently.
  6. Garnish with fresh mint leaves and a lime wedge.

Notes

Chill your glass for extra coolness. Adjust sweetness of the simple syrup to taste. Use larger ice cubes for slower melting.
